St. Vincent’s Emerging From ‘Daunting’ Bankruptcy (The New York Sun)

St. Vincent Catholic Medical Centers is set to emerge from bankruptcy more than two years after filing for Chapter 11 protection, after a court confirmed its reorganization plan. Delta shares hit post-bankruptcy low (Atlanta Journal-Constitution)

Delta Air Lines’ shares were down about 3 percent Monday afternoon, hitting their lowest level since the airline emerged from bankruptcy three months ago. Delta’s slipping stock price came as the airline began distributing 21 million additional shares Monday to creditors as it resolves various disputes from its bankrputcy restructuring. Calpine bankruptcy reorganization plan on hold (San Jose Mercury News)

Power producer Calpine put its bankruptcy reorganization plan on hold so it can talk with unidentified third parties about an alternative that would give creditors a guaranteed payout.
